What is driving Western Digital Corp (WDC)’s stock price down today?

Western Digital’s sharp stock decline and intense intraday volatility are primarily driven by a broad, sector-wide selloff in semiconductor and digital storage names. Although the hardware maker has benefited immensely from the artificial intelligence infrastructure boom, it became caught in a wider tech rout after Samsung Electronics released its preliminary earnings update.

Even though Samsung reported a massive nineteen-fold surge in operating profit, investors seized on the strong report as an opportunity to lock in gains, triggering a classic "sell-the-news" reaction across the global tech hardware sector. This profit-taking quickly spread to major U.S. memory and storage companies. High-flying peers like Micron Technology and SanDisk also experienced severe downward pressure, which in turn dragged down Western Digital’s stock price. Because Western Digital carries significant weight in prominent technology and memory exchange-traded funds, institutional rebalancing and automated sell programs accelerated the intraday downward momentum.

The steep decline reflects mounting market anxiety that the aggressive hardware and memory rally may have run too hot. Recent concerns raised by some analysts suggest that expectations surrounding hard-disk drive pricing power and near-term cloud spending might have reached overly optimistic levels, raising fears of a potential near-term ceiling. Furthermore, because Western Digital relies heavily on a concentrated base of major hyperscale cloud providers for its data-storage solutions, it remains vulnerable to sudden shifts in capital expenditure plans from these tech giants, compounding investor caution ahead of its next quarterly earnings release.

Despite the steep daily pullback, Wall Street analysts remain fundamentally constructive on the company. Major investment banks, including Bank of America and Cantor Fitzgerald, recently raised their price targets on the stock. Analysts emphasize that the structural demand for storage capacity remains exceptionally strong, as Western Digital’s enterprise hard disk drive capacity is reportedly fully booked through the calendar year to support AI training and enterprise data centers. However, this positive fundamental backdrop has not been enough to shield the stock from the immediate, sector-wide momentum shift.

Company Specific Risks:

  • Vulnerability to Peak HDD Pricing Caps: Fox Advisors recently downgraded the stock to Equal-Weight, warning that the market's highly optimistic expectations for high-capacity hard disk drive (HDD) pricing and gross margins have outpaced physical demand, indicating that pricing premiums charged to cloud providers are hitting a near-term ceiling.
  • Severe Customer Concentration and Capex Exposure: Following the corporate split from its flash-memory business (SanDisk), Western Digital operates as a pure-play HDD company, exposing its revenue directly to sudden capital expenditure pauses or inventory adjustments from a highly concentrated group of major cloud hyperscalers.
  • Equity Dilution from Convertible Notes Exchange: In an amended Form 8-K filing, the company finalized the exchange of approximately $858.4 million of its 3.00% Convertible Senior Notes due 2028, resulting in the dilutive issuance of 21,289,938 new shares of common stock.
  • High Transition and Execution Risks: The company's near-term margin trajectory depends heavily on flawlessly ramping and scaling its complex, next-generation 40-terabyte energy-assisted PMR (ePMR) and Heat-Assisted Magnetic Recording (HAMR) drives, where any yield issues or technical delays could compress margins and hand market share to competitors.
